State laws require public companies to hold a meeting of shareholders every year, and the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) requires publicly traded companies to file proxy statements ahead of annual shareholders' meetings and special meetings.

Proxy statements must offer insights into board and company performance, including: The salaries of the company's five highest-paid executives (including bonuses and equity) and the appropriate benchmark in chart form. Executive performance and the performance of executives of similar companies.
Proxy | Business English a written document that officially gives someone the authority to do something for another person, for example by voting at a meeting for them: A creditor may give a proxy to any person of full age requiring him or her to vote for or against any specified resolution.
Proxy statements are documents that the Securities and Exchange Commission requires companies to give to shareholders so they can weigh in on important company issues. Proxy statements offer shareholders information about changes on the board and other important decisions the board needs to make.
Proxy materials are filed to shareholders before annual meetings to disclose important information and give them a chance to vote on basic issues.
